Activity Summary for past 24 hours: At the summit, DI inflation started overnight and the summit lava lake rose with it. At Pu`u `O`o, there were no significant changes in the crater. To the southeast of Pu`u `O`o, lava flow activity on the coastal plain was weak and scattered while new pali breakouts started overnight. Seismic tremor levels were low; gas emissions were elevated.

Past 24 hours at Kilauea summit: The summit tiltmeters recorded the switch to DI inflation about 8 pm last night. The lava lake level rose with the inflation. The most recent (preliminary) sulfur dioxide emission rate measurement was 700 tonnes/day on July 26, 2012. In addition to gas, very small amounts of ash-sized tephra (spatter bits and Pele's hair) were carried out of the vent in the gas plume and deposited on nearby surfaces.

The GPS network recorded no significant changes (neither extension nor contraction) since mid-June; summit tilt records also showed no significant long-term trend. Seismic tremor levels were low. Only one earthquake was strong enough to be located beneath Kilauea volcano on south flank faults.

Background: The summit lava lake is deep within a ~160 m (520 ft) diameter cylindrical vent with nearly vertical sides inset within the east wall and floor of Halema`uma`u Crater. Its level fluctuates from about 60 m to more than 150 m (out of sight) below the floor of Halema`uma`u Crater. The vent has been mostly active since opening with a small explosive event on March 19, 2008. Most recently, the lava level of the lake has remained below an inner ledge (60 m or 200 ft below the floor of Halema`uma`u Crater on May 9, 2012) and responded to summit tilt changes with the lake receding during deflation and rising during inflation.

Past 24 hours at the middle east rift zone vents: Webcams recorded weakened breakouts on the pali being overridden by new breakouts from the top of the pali overnight. In addition, there were a few scattered active lava lobes on the coastal plain.

The tiltmeter on the north flank of Pu`u `O`o cone recorded DI inflation that slowly increased in rate overnight. There were no significant changes in Pu`u `O`o crater: glow from the lava pond in the northeastern collapse pit (7-8 m, or 23-26 ft, below its rim on July 12 and out of direct view of the PTcam) and the two sources along the south edge of the crater floor were visible. Seismic tremor levels near Pu`u `O`o remained low. GPS receivers on opposite sides of the cone recorded no contraction or extension since mid-June. The most recent (preliminary) sulfur dioxide emission rate measurement was 300 tonnes/day on August 2, 2012, from all east rift zone sources.

Background: The eruption in Kilauea's middle east rift zone started with a fissure eruption on January 3, 1983, and continued with few interruptions at Pu`u `O`o Cone, or temporarily from vents within a few kilometers to the east or west,. A fissure eruption on the upper east flank of Pu`u `O`o Cone on Sept. 21, 2011, drained the lava lakes and fed a lava flow that advanced southeast through the abandoned Royal Gardens subdivision to the ocean within Hawai`i Volcanoes National Park in early December. Since late December, the flows have remained intermittently active on the pali and the coastal plain but have not entered the ocean. In general, activity waxes with inflation and wanes with deflation.

Hazard Summary: East rift vents and flow field - near-vent areas could erupt or collapse without warning with spatter and/or ash being wafted within the gas plume; potentially-lethal concentrations of sulfur dioxide gas may be present within 1 km downwind of vent areas. All recently active lava flows are within Hawai`i Volcanoes National Park, adjacent State land managed by the Department of Land and Natural Resources, and private property within the Royal Gardens subdivision; the lava flows do not pose a hazard to any structures not already within the County-declared mandatory evacuation zone. Kilauea Crater - ash and Pele's hair can be carried several kilometers downwind; potentially-lethal concentrations of sulfur dioxide can be present within 1 km downwind.

Viewing Summary: East rift zone flow field - Active lava flows within the closed-access Kahauale'a Natural Area Reserve (NAR) and the evacuated Royal Gardens subdivision can only be viewed from the air. Under favorable weather conditions, the flows can be seen from the County Viewing Area at Kalapana (Lava hotline 961-8093) and in the R2, R3, and R4 webcams. Pu`u `O`o Cone, the strip of coastal plain nearest the ocean within which the lava is now advancing, and Kilauea Crater - these areas are within Hawai`i Volcanoes National Park; Park access and viewing information can be found at http://www.nps.gov/havo/planyourvisit/lava2.htm.
